    Le Meilleur De Véronique Jannot is a 2002 best-of compilation that brings together some of the most notable recordings from French singer and actress Véronique Jannot. Blending synth-pop production with classic chanson and emotional balladry, the collection highlights her distinctive soft vocal style and the atmospheric arrangements that defined much of her work in the 1980s and early 1990s. The songs often combine melodic pop structures with gentle electronic textures, creating an elegant and sentimental listening experience. Tracks like Aviateur and Désir, Désir showcase her most recognizable hits, while deeper cuts reveal a more intimate and reflective side. The inclusion of bonus tracks from the TV series Pause Café adds nostalgic value and broadens the compilation’s appeal. Overall, this release serves as a concise portrait of her musical career, emphasizing both her pop success and her contribution to French synth-driven chanson.

    UTFO Hits is a retrospective compilation released in 1998 that highlights the influential legacy of UTFO (Untouchable Force Organization), one of the pioneering groups in early hip-hop culture. Originating from Brooklyn, New York, the group played a significant role in shaping the sound and storytelling style of mid-1980s rap. This collection brings together their most recognized tracks along with interludes featuring commentary from prominent figures within the hip-hop community. The album is anchored by the classic "Roxanne, Roxanne," a groundbreaking track that sparked the legendary Roxanne Wars, one of the earliest and most notable rap rivalries. The compilation blends playful lyrical delivery, minimalistic beats, and early sampling techniques that defined the old-school era. UTFO Hits serves as both a historical document and an engaging listen, capturing the raw creativity and competitive spirit of hip-hop’s formative years.

    Dolce Vita (Lo Mejor Del Italo-Dance) is a comprehensive anthology celebrating the most influential Italo-disco and synth-pop hits of the 1980s and 1990s. This 3-CD compilation features iconic tracks from artists such as Ryan Paris, Ken Laszlo, Savage, Den Harrow, and F.R. David, capturing the era’s energetic melodies, catchy hooks, and electronic instrumentation. Each CD is curated to deliver a unique listening experience: CD1 presents the original hits, CD2 offers deeper tracks and fan favorites, and CD3 Non Stop Dolce Vita provides a continuous dance mix for uninterrupted enjoyment. With its rich selection of both chart-toppers and rare gems, the album exemplifies the exuberance and international appeal of Italo-disco music, making it essential for fans and newcomers alike who seek to relive or discover the vibrant dancefloor soundscapes of the period.

    Reference 80 is a retrospective compilation by Magazine 60, highlighting the group's vibrant contribution to the Italo-disco and Europop scene. Known for their catchy melodies, playful themes, and synth-driven arrangements, Magazine 60 gained popularity in the 1980s with dancefloor-oriented tracks that blended humor and exotic imagery. This collection gathers their most iconic songs along with instrumental and extended maxi versions, offering a comprehensive look at their signature sound. Tracks like "Don Quichotte" and "Pancho Villa" showcase their upbeat style and memorable hooks, while the extended mixes provide a deeper club-oriented experience. The album captures the colorful essence of the era with polished production and infectious rhythms. Reference 80 serves as both a nostalgic journey for longtime fans and an accessible entry point for listeners discovering classic European disco and synth-pop.

    Reference 80 is a comprehensive compilation by Century, highlighting the band’s signature blend of melodic pop rock, emotional ballads, and synth-driven dance tracks that defined their sound. Released in 2012, this collection revisits the group's most recognizable material with extended versions, alternate mixes, and rare cuts that showcase their versatility and songwriting depth. Century is best known for their international hit "Lover Why," which appears here in a full-length version, emphasizing its atmospheric arrangement and memorable vocal delivery. The album balances upbeat, rhythm-focused tracks with softer, introspective songs, creating a dynamic listening experience. With polished production and a distinctly European pop sensibility, Reference 80 serves both as an essential introduction for new listeners and a valuable retrospective for fans, capturing the essence of the band's contribution to 1980s-inspired pop music.
